forked from wrenn/wrenn
Metrics data was only fetched after Chart.js dynamic import completed, leaving graphs empty until the first poll interval fired. Now loadMetrics() runs in parallel with the Chart.js import, and initCharts() resets the dedup key so pre-fetched data populates newly created chart instances.